Olive oil tasting introduces yet another layer, guided by a specialist who leads guests through the aromas and virtues of the island’s acclaimed olive oil. At Pithari, the ceramic heritage of Crete is presented through objects that tell stories of skill and time. Cretan winemaking reaches its most refined moment through the Wine and Cellar Experience, a private tasting set in the resort’s cellar. Indigenous varieties like Vidiano and Kotsifali are paired with select cheeses and meze in a journey shaped by culture, scent and texture.
